Established in 1998, and the legacy of acknowledging the talents by the Meril-Prothom Alo Award still continues, surpassing two successful decades. The ultimate aim of commencing such events is to celebrate and foster a content of movies and stories in Dhallywood/Bangladesh Film industry. Both the newspaper Prothom Alo and Square Toiletries Limited togetherly organize the award show yearly. And for the year 2024, the three categories including Limited Length Feature Film, Film & Web Film, Web Series and their nominations have been unfurled. Here are they,
